Abstract
A method of signal shielding in X-ray detectors and X-ray detectors using such a method are disclosed herein. In one embodiment, the X-ray detector has a set of detector elements placed on a substrate, and the shielding method includes providing a conductive shield above the data lines which carry the output signals of the detector elements. In another embodiment, the X-ray detector has a set of detector elements place on a substrate, and the method of signal shielding includes providing data lines on a flex layer that'"'"'s bonded to a substrate, placing a conductive shield above the data lines, placing a flex shield on an interior surface of the flex layer, and conducting electromagnetic noise through the conductive shield and the flex shield.
